Incorporation of UQCRFS1 is the penµLtimate step in complex III assembly (PubMed:28673544). Cytochrome b-c1 complex subunit 9: Possible component of the mitochondrial ubiquinol-cytochrome c reductase complex dimer (complex III dimer), which is a respiratory chain that generates an electrochemical potential coupled to ATP synthesis (PubMed:28673544). UQCRFS1 undergoes proteolytic processing once it is incorporated in the complex III dimer, including this fragment, called subunit 9, which corresponds to the transit peptide (PubMed:28673544). The proteolytic processing is necessary for the correct insertion of UQCRFS1 in the complex III dimer, but the persistence of UQCRFS1-derived fragments may prevent newly imported UQCRFS1 to be processed and assembled into complex III and is detrimental for the complex III structure and function (PubMed:28673544). It is therefore unsure whether the UQCRFS1 fragments, including this fragment, are structural subunits (PubMed:28673544).
